TAIPEI, TAIWAN (January 17, 2022) Acer today announced that it will begin carrying PCs which run on Windows 11 SE, starting with the Acer TravelMate B3 and Acer TravelMate Spin B3 laptops. The portable 11.6-inch laptops were built to survive the school-day, boasting military-grade durability certifications[3] and a 10-hour battery life[4], and now come pre-installed with Windows 11 SE or Windows 11 Pro Education. Additionally, the devices’ chassis have been constructed with over 14% post-consumer recycled plastic.

Acer has been working closely with Microsoft in order to provide devices for pilot programs that bring Windows 11 SE to schools around the world. It is one of the first brands to carry devices featuring the new operating system.

Acer TravelMate B3 and Acer TravelMate Spin B3

Featuring the latest Intel® Pentium® Silver and Celeron® processors, the TravelMate B3 and TravelMate Spin B3 are dependable laptops that were built to support the needs of K-12 schoolchildren. The laptops are MIL-STD 810H[5] certified and feature shock-absorbent bumpers, making them tough enough to withstand up to 60 kg (132.28 lbs) of downward force and drops from up to 4 ft (1.22 m). A unique drainage design helps to protect internal components from moderate spills[6]. A mechanically-anchored key design provides a double benefit: The entire keyboard can be easily replaced by administrators, but individual keys are well-secured so that they won’t be dislodged by restless fingers.

Durability aside, a number of thoughtful features help the laptops find their place within the classroom. Intel® Wi-Fi 6 (Gig+) with 2x2 MU-MIMO technology helps with connectivity in multi-user environments, and optional 4G LTE provides students with a connection when away from a router. A webcam makes the laptops suitable for taking classes from home, while a 10-hour battery life means that they can make it through the full school day, too. Teachers will appreciate the battery indicator on the device’s front cover, allowing them to tell at a glance if a student’s device needs to be charged.

The Acer TravelMate Spin B3 comes equipped with Acer Antimicrobial Design[1,2] — it features not only an Antimicrobial Corning® Gorilla® Glass[1] touchscreen, but also an antimicrobial (silver-ion) coating on commonly-used high-touch surfaces (including the keyboard, touchpad, and palm-rest surface) to protect these surfaces. Users can further opt to include a dockable Wacom AES pen and 5 MP HDR world-facing camera, allowing schools to customize their laptops in order to suit their students’ specific needs.

Windows 11 SE

A new, cloud-first Windows edition built for inclusive and accessible learning, Windows 11 SE offers the performance and reliability of Windows 11 in addition to a simplified design and modern management tools that have been optimized for low-cost devices in educational settings. Featuring an easy-to-use interface plus an education-first menu of curated apps, Windows 11 SE comes on affordable devices that are pre-configured for student privacy and remote management. And, with a cleaner interface and fewer distractions, Windows 11 SE helps students focus on learning while preserving valuable class time for instruction.

The TravelMate B3 and TravelMate Spin B3 laptops are also available with Windows 11 Pro Education.

Pricing and Availability

The TravelMate B3 (TMB311-32) will be available in EMEA in Q1’22, starting at EUR 359; and in China in March, starting at RMB 3,499.

The TravelMate Spin B3 (TMB311R-32) will be available in EMEA in Q1’22, starting at EUR 539.
